Application and development of pyrolysis technology in petroleum oily sludge treatment

Abstract: With the enhancement of public awareness of environmental protection, the harm of oily sludge has gradually been paid attention to. As a kind of dangerous solid waste, the arbitrary disposal of oily sludge will cause quite serious harm to both the environment and human beings. Research on the treatment methods of oily sludge has become a hot spot recently. “…Biological Treatment Technology. Biological treatment is a process that uses microorganisms to decompose the hydrocarbons in the oily sludge into carbon dioxide and water to achieve harmlessness [11]. Most of the petroleum products in oil oily sludge can be decomposed by microorganisms, and the decomposition rate is mainly affected by the composition of hydrocarbons.…”

“…Oily sludge is not inherent in nature but is a mixture of oil, soil, and water, even mixed with other pollutants from oilfield exploitation, the oil refining process, transportation, use, and storage. Oily sludge is harmful to human beings, plants and water organisms and is one of the main pollutants in the petroleum and petrochemical industries [1]. Therefore, research on the reduction and harmless treatment of oily sludge has always been an important issue in oil production [2].…”
